Swimming & Diving to Host Fairfield

Red Foxes Host Second Home Meet of The Season

POUGHKEEPSIE, New York - The Marist men's and women's swimming & diving teams are at home for the second time this season, as MAAC opponent Fairfield travels to the McCann Natatorium Saturday, Nov. 5 at 1 p.m.

 
Last Time Out For Men
  • James Conable won the 500 free (4:41.94), and the 1,000 free (9:42.50).
  • Ahmed Sallam secured first place in the 50 free (21.10), finished second in the 100 free (45.72), and took home third in the 100 backstroke (51.83). He also came in third in the 200 medley relay (1:36.04).
 
Last Time Out For Women
  • The relay team of Veronica Stureborg, Lucie Gray, Sophia Swanson, and Nellie Thompson was victorious in the 200 medley (1:52.26).
  • The relay team of Margaret Hartman, Charlotte Lepis, Swanson, and Thompson won the 400 free relay (3:41.44).
  • Madeline Healey took first place in the 1,000 free (10:46.92) and 500 free (5:19.29).
  • Thompson won the 50 free (25.14) and 100 free (54.47).
  • Gray prevailed in the 100 breaststroke and 200 breaststroke (2:28.39).
  • Stureborg and Molly Hewett finished first and second respectively in the 100 backstroke.
  • Leigh-Anne Zanella and Melanie Nunn finished one-two in the 200 butterfly.
  • In the 3-meter diving event, Kyra Cavicchi finished first, while Morgan Cassidy took second place.
  • Madison Sweeney won the 1-meter event, as Cavicchi and Cassidy came in second and third.
